There are eight.

1 Qingdao Liuting International Airport is located in Chengyang District, Qingdao, about 23 kilometers away from the city center. Qingdao Liuting International Airport is a 4E-class civil international airport and one of the 12 major trunk airports in China. Liuting International Airport was built in 1944, and currently has two terminals, T 1 and T2, with a total area of about120,000 square meters.

2. Jinan Yao Qiang International Airport is located in Licheng District, Jinan City, about 30 kilometers away from the city center. Yao Qiang International Airport is a 4E civil international airport. 1992 was completed and opened to traffic, which was the largest single-ended steel frame structure in China at that time.

At present, there is a terminal building with an area of165438+40,000 square meters and a runway length of 3,600 meters. The construction of the North Finger Gallery is in progress and will soon be completed and put into use. In the future, Jinan Yao Qiang International Airport will build a second terminal and a second runway.

3. Yantai Penglai International Airport is located in Penglai District, Yantai City, about 43 kilometers away from the center of Yantai. It is a 4E-class civil international airport with a terminal area of about 96,000 square meters and a runway length of 3,400 meters. The second-phase expansion project of Yantai Penglai International Airport started in 2065,438+09. In order to meet the rapidly growing demand, the second-phase expansion project will build a T2 terminal of 200,000 square meters.

4. Dongying Shengli Airport, located in Kenli District, Dongying City, is about13km away from the city center. Dongying Shengli Airport is a 4D civil airport. At present, it has a terminal building with an area of 26,000 square meters and a runway with a length of 3,600 meters.

Weihai International Airport is located in Weihai, about 40 kilometers away from the city center. Weihai International Airport is a 4D civil airport with a terminal area of about 654.38+400,000 square meters and a runway length of 2,600 meters.

6. Linyi Qiyang Airport is located in Hedong District, Linyi City, about 8 kilometers away from the urban area. Linyi Qiyang Airport is a 4D civil airport, built in 1934, which is the first civil airport in Shandong Province. The airport has two terminals, T 1 and T2, with an area of * * * 23,000 square meters and a runway of 3,200 meters.

7. Rizhao Shanzihe Airport, located in Donggang District of Rizhao City, is 0/9 km away from the city center. Rizhao Shanzihe Airport is a 4C-class airport. At present, it has a T 1 terminal building with an area of 22,000 square meters and a runway length of 2,600 meters.

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port, located in jiaozhou city, Qingdao, is a 4F-class civil hub international airport with a terminal building area of 478,000 square meters and two runways of 3,600 meters. Two short-distance runways will be built in the future. The airport project was completed in 20 19, and has not been put into use yet. It is expected to be put into use in 2020, and new terminals T2 and T3 will be built in the future.

At present, the main trunk airports in Shandong Province are

Jinan Yao Qiang International Airport, Qingdao Liuting International Airport and Yantai Penglai International Airport are all regional airports. At present, the number of civil airports in Shandong may not be as good as that in Jiangsu, but a number of new airports are being built in Zibo, Zaozhuang, Weifang, Jining, Tai 'an, Heze, Dezhou, Liaocheng and Binzhou, which means that every prefecture-level city in Shandong will soon have its own civil airport.

There are two airports in Qingdao.

There are two airports in Qingdao. One is Qingdao Liuting International Airport and the other is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port (under construction.

Qingdao Liuting International Airport: Qingdao Liuting International Airport (IATA:TAO, ICAO:ZSQD) is located in Liuting Street, Chengyang District, Qingdao City, Shandong Province, China. It is a first-class civil international airport and one of the twelve major trunk airports in China. Qingdao Liuting International Machine was built in1944; 1987165438+10 to complete the first phase expansion project; Completed the second phase expansion project in 2004; It was upgraded to an international airport in 2005; In 2007, the third phase expansion project was completed. As of August 20 17, Qingdao liuting international airport has two terminals with a total area of120,000 square meters. It has a runway 3400 meters long and 45 meters wide, with 70 seats; The platform area of Terminal 1 is184,000 square meters; 2065438+2006 * * * operated regular routes 133, with 77 navigable cities.

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port: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port is located at 1 1 km northeast of jiaozhou city center under the jurisdiction of Qingdao, west of Dagu River, east of East Outer Ring Road, between Ji Jiao Railway and Ji Jiao Passenger Dedicated Line, about 39 kilometers away from Qingdao center. According to the overall work plan,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port started construction in 20 15, with a total construction period of four years. It is expected to be completed and accepted in 20 19. The target year of this project is 2025. The total investment of the project is about 3865438+75 million yuan, including 30.045 billion yuan for the airport project. Two parallel long-distance runways will be built, with a runway length of 3,600 meters, a runway spacing of 2,200 meters and a terminal area of 450,000 square meters.

1. Two civil transport airports

1, Qingdao Liuting International Airport, flight zone class 4E. In 20 19, Qingdao liuting international airport * * completed the annual passenger throughput of 25,556,300 passengers, up by 4.2% year-on-year, ranking the mainland as16; The cargo and mail throughput was 256,300 tons, up 14. 1% year-on-year, ranking 14 in the mainland. Aircraft take-off and landing 186,500 sorties, up 2. 1% year-on-year, ranking18 in the mainland.

2.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port (under construction, the planned flight area is 4F. At present, there is no 4F airport in Shandong Province. Upon completion,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port will be the first 4F airport in Shandong Province, and Qingdao will also have two international airports.

Second, two general airports.

1, Qingdao West Coast Airport, general airport class B, the operator and owner of the airport is Qingdao West Coast General Aviation Industry Development Co., Ltd., and the runway length and width are both 200 * 30m, which is a ground heliport.

2. Qingdao Cihang Airport, with general airport category A 1, is the first runway-type general airport with Class A use license in Shandong Peninsula, which is invested and operated by Qingdao Cihang General Aviation Service Co., Ltd. ..

At present, the airport being used in Qingdao is Qingdao Liuting International Airport, which is located in the jurisdiction of Liuting Street, Chengyang District, Qingdao. As early as the early 1930s, Qingdao Airport, based on Cangkou Airport, began to operate, but it was suspended after several twists and turns. 1982 liuting civil aviation Qingdao station was completed and resumed; 1987 1 1 Complete the first phase expansion project; Completed the second phase expansion project in 2004; It was upgraded to an international airport in 2005; In 2007, the third phase expansion project was completed. The airport flight area is 4e, the apron area is 440,000 square meters, and there are 65,438 boarding bridges with 44 seats. The airport terminal covers an area of1.2000 square meters, which can meet the transportation needs of annual passengers1.2000 passengers, annual mail of 200,000 tons and 5 1.20 passengers during peak hours. Qingdao Airport has 82 domestic routes and international (regional) routes 12, reaching 50 domestic cities and 8 international (regional) cities such as Seoul, Tokyo and Hong Kong. This is also one of the twelve major trunk airports in China.

20 1 1 Qingdao new airport has been included in the 12th Five-Year Development Plan of China National Economy, the National Comprehensive Transportation System Plan, the National Civil Airport Layout Plan and the 12th Five-Year Development Plan of China Civil Aviation. Airport positioning has also been upgraded from the original ordinary trunk airport to a regional gateway hub airport. On September 27th, 20 13, the site selection report of Qingdao new airport was officially approved by the Civil Aviation Administration of China. The reply said that the site selection of Qingdao New Airport, which has attracted much attention from the society, has settled in jiaozhou city Jiaodong Sub-district Office. This is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port under construction.

According to the plan,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port operates at 4F (Qingdao Liuting Airport is 4E, which is the highest level. At present, Airbus A380 and Boeing 747-800, which can take off and land, are the largest aircraft, compared with Beijing Capital International Airport, Tianjin Binhai International Airport, Shanghai Pudong International Airport,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port, Chengdu Shuangliu International Airport, kunming changshui international airport, Guilin Liangjiang International Airport and Xi Xianyang International Airport 165438. The total construction period is four years, and the completion acceptance is expected on 20 19.

What is the name of the airport in Qingdao?

The airport in Qingdao is called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port.

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port, located in Qiandiankou Village, Jiaodong Street, jiaozhou city, Qingdao, Shandong Province, China, is away from jiaozhou city Center 1 1km in the southwest, 39km from Qingdao Center in the southeast, 28km from Qingdao Liuting International Airport in the southeast and 6km from Navy Jiaozhou Airport in the west. It is a 4F-class international airport, a regional hub airport and a gateway airport for Japan and South Korea.

2065438+On June 26th, 2005, the foundation stone was laid for the new airport project in Qingdao. 2018165438+1October 2 1, and Qingdao new airport was named "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port"; 202 1 1 27, Qingdao Jiaodong international airport successfully flew; On 2021August 12, Qingdao Jiaodong International Airport was officially opened to traffic.
